I'm no videographer, especially when I'm on limited free time, but here's a walk-through of the Viking Village at Lily Fest this weekend. I've participated in this group for about 20 years, and it's always interesting to see how the village grows and changes from year to year. We have more crafters, folks working on projects and displaying tools, talking about Viking and Medieval culture. Kids trade small items with some of the Vikings, while parents take a turn at throwing axes. This year we've got a group of musicians occasionally strolling the camp playing an assortment of string instruments.
